Description
Job Title : Unarmed Security Guard Job Location: 555 Battery Street, Suite 121, San Francisco, CA 94111. Job Type: Full Time. Requirements: The candidate shall have a High School Diploma or GED The candidate shall have a Clean Criminal Record: A thorough background check will be conducted, and a clean criminal record is essential. Certain felonies or significant misdemeanors will disqualify an applicant. The candidate must comply with California security personnel laws: Laws and Regulations – Bureau of Security and Investigative Services. The candidate shall be familiar with Computerized Tracking System Operations: Proficiency in operating computerized tracking systems (e.g., Tracktik or similar NPS COR approved system) for logging patrols. The candidate shall be familiar with Two-Way Radio Operations: Ability to carry, operate, and troubleshoot an NPS-supplied two-way radio for continuous communication with the NPS communication center. The candidate shall have Basic Computer Proficiency: For logging reports and potentially other digital communications. Duties: Security Patrols: Conduct regular, uniformed security patrols of the Hyde Street Pier, its buildings, and historic ships. Patrol Logging: Operate a computerized tracking system (e.g., Tracktik) to record patrols at 26 synchronized locations within Hyde Street Pier. Vary Patrols: Ensure patrol times vary to avoid predictable intervals, maintaining a minimum of a two-hour gap between patrols. Site Presence: Remain on duty at the assigned site throughout the shift. Relief Management: Only leave the site if a qualified replacement (another contractor security officer or an on-duty park ranger) provides relief. Radio Operation: Carry and operate an NPS-supplied two-way radio for communication. Radio Maintenance Reporting: Note any inoperable radios in the log for repair or replacement and obtain a temporary replacement from the Park COR. Communication Center Notification: Notify the National Park Service (NPS) communication center via radio prior to and after each patrol, and during any unusual or emergency situations. Intruder Response (Non-Confrontational): If suspicious behavior or activity is observed, immediately contact the NPS communication center and report the intrusion (location, description of individuals). Stay out of sight, if possible, until assistance arrives. Do not approach intruders. Call the NPS communication center before investigating suspected intrusions or dockings. Docking Attempt Response: Use a high-candle powered beam light to ward off boats attempting to land on premises. May use a bullhorn to advise vessels to steer clear. If a vessel closes to voice range, advise it to steer clear or that the US Coast Guard and United States Park Police will be notified. If a vessel continues to attempt docking, immediately notify the NPS communication center via radio, providing vessel type, hull number (if possible), location, and number of people. Do not confront intruders once a vessel docks; maintain visual contact and relay observations while awaiting assistance.
